#07783E Color
#07783E is rgb(7, 120, 62) in RGB, hsl(149, 89%, 25%) in HSL, and about cmyk(94%, 0%, 48%, 53%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Dartmouth Green (#00703C),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 4.28.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#07783E Channel Values
How #07783E bre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 7 · G 120 · B 62 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 149° · S 89% · L 25%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 149° · S 94% · V 47%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 94% · M 0% · Y 48% · K 53%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 5.58:1 vs white · 3.77: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#07783E background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#07783E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#07783E?
#07783E is a dark green — rgb(7, 120, 62) in RGB and hsl(149, 89%, 25%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Dartmouth Green (#00703C),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 4.28.
What is the RGB value of #07783E?
#07783E is rgb(7, 120, 62) — red 7, green 120, and blue 62 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#07783E?
#07783E converts to approximately cmyk(94%, 0%, 48%, 53%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#07783E be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#07783E scores 5.58:1 against white and 3.77: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#07783E as a CSS color keyword?
No. #07783E is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is seagreen (#2E8B57) at a CIE76 distance of 8.78,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
